Rooms
Tung Nam Lou Art Hotel offers a range of distinctive accommodations that blend comfort with artistic expression. The Signature Two-Bedroom Penthouse Duplex accommodates up to 6 adults and 2 children, featuring expansive city and harbor views, two living rooms, and ample storage. Other room options include the Deluxe Book Art King, where guests can immerse themselves in literature and music, and the SOUTH ROOM, which showcases an energizing view of the Kowloon skyline.

Cultural Experience
The hotel embraces local culture through its involvement in photography and art, encouraging guests to participate in the 'Lights on Yau Ma Tei' Cinematic Photography Competition. This initiative invites participants to capture the essence of Hong Kong's cinematic history through their lens. Selected works will be exhibited, creating a unique opportunity for guests to connect with the local community.

Property information and rules
Check-in
from 15:00-23:59
Check-out
until 12 pm
Guest Parking
No parking available.
Internet
Wireless internet is available in public areas for free.
Children & extra beds
There are no extra beds provided in a room.
Pets
Pets are not allowed.
Number of rooms:
51

Is it possible to store our luggage at your location before check-in and after check-out times?
05 December 2024
Luggage can be stored at no charge on the day of check-in and until 10 PM on the day of check-out. After 10 PM, a fee of HKD 50 per piece of luggage per night will apply.

Can packages be received at the hotel prior to a guest's check-in?
25 May 2025
Packages can be received, but they must match the booking name. If they arrive before check-in, a storage fee of HKD 50 per day will apply.

What are the general check-in and check-out times, and is flexibility available?
22 September 2025
Check-in begins at 15:00 and check-out is at 12:00 noon. Early check-in and late check-out may be arranged for an additional fee of HKD 100 per hour based on availability.
